Lorraine J. (Roberts) Lundstrom, 95, of Bristol, died Saturday,  Jan. 13, 2018, at the Grace Barker Nursing Home, Warren.

She was the wife of the late Russell Gordon Lundstrom Sr.

Lorraine was born in Feeding Hills, Mass., a daughter of the late David Van Buren Roberts and Laura M. (Miner) Roberts.

She was a homemaker.

Mrs. Lundstrom has lived in Bristol for over 60 years, coming from Warren.

She was a member of the First Congregational Church in Bristol, where she was a member of the choir for over 20 years, and a member of the Junior Women’s Club. She was also an avid gardener.

She enjoyed sewing, reading and swimming.

Mrs. Lundstrom is survived by her son, Russell Gordon Lundstrom Jr., of Bristol.

Lorraine was the mother of the late Dr. Karen Lundstrom Baudais.

She was the sister of the late Antoinette Whitney, Helen Yvonne Lyman, and also sister of Blanche Whitman.

Her funeral services will be held Friday, Jan. 19, at 11 a.m. in the SMITH FUNERAL and MEMORIAL SERVICES, 8 Schoolhouse Road, Warren. Burial will follow in North Burial Ground, Hope Street, Bristol.

Relatives and friends are invited to attend.
